I Am a Cat: Chapter I, Chapter II Raul Pato Martín they must act fastThis English version of (Wagahai wa neko de aru: I Am a Cat), Chapters I and II, written by Natsume Sseki, pseudonym of Natsume Kinnosuke (1867 1916), and translated by Kan ichi Ando (1878 1924), was published by Hattori Shoten, Tokyo, in 1906. It begins: "I am a cat; but as yet I have no name."
